From 5a6bfc5d02e2ae72c4a1aefb3922fc4d69c24d66 Mon Sep 17 00:00:00 2001 From: ilotterytea Date: Thu, 1 Sep 2022 23:25:10 +0600 Subject: данк кнопочька M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../ilotterytea/maxoning/ui/SupaIconButton.java | 24 ++++++++++++++++++++++ 1 file changed, 24 insertions(+) create mode 100644 core/src/com/ilotterytea/maxoning/ui/SupaIconButton.java diff --git a/core/src/com/ilotterytea/maxoning/ui/SupaIconButton.java b/core/src/com/ilotterytea/maxoning/ui/SupaIconButton.java new file mode 100644 index 0000000..d84be68 --- /dev/null +++ b/core/src/com/ilotterytea/maxoning/ui/SupaIconButton.java @@ -0,0 +1,24 @@ +package com.ilotterytea.maxoning.ui; + +import com.badlogic.gdx.graphics.g2d.NinePatch; +import com.badlogic.gdx.scenes.scene2d.ui.*; +import com.badlogic.gdx.utils.Align; + +public class SupaIconButton extends Stack { + + public SupaIconButton( + NinePatch ninepatch, + CharSequence text, + Skin skin + ) { + super(new Image(ninepatch)); + + Label label = new Label(text, skin); + Table table = new Table(); + + label.setAlignment(Align.center); + + table.add(label).expand().fillX().center().left(); + super.add(table); + } +} -- cgit v1.2.3